💡 FUN FACT TIME:
During the late 1800s and early 1900s, The Rocks was ground zero for deadly outbreaks, including the bubonic plague. To stop the spread, entire blocks were walled off, homes were forcibly barricaded, and infected residents were dragged away by "cleansing brigades." Entire underground networks and basements became makeshift quarantine zones and holding areas for the dead. The sheer panic and despair of that era left a heavy, unmistakable energy in the cellars beneath these very pubs.

Deep underground tunnels, a missing Prime Minister, and a 6-inch gun that changed history.

Most people visit Point Nepean for the ocean views and the coastal breeze. But if you know where to look, the ground beneath your feet tells a completely different story.

The ultimate trivia drop:
Imagine standing at Fort Nepean in August 1914. The world is on the brink of war. A German freighter tries to flee the bay—and boom. The very first shot fired by the British Empire in WWI happens right here. Fast forward to 1939? It happens again for WWII. This tiny stretch of land literally bookended modern history.

On our "Frontline Fortress" tour, we don't just point at old bricks. We take you down into the eerie, underground concrete tunnels where soldiers stood guard, and look out over Cheviot Beach—the exact spot where Prime Minister Harold Holt walked into the surf in 1967 and simply vanished into thin air.

🔍 DID YOU KNOW?

The Human Map: Look closely at the stone walls—you can still see carvings of sailing ships made by inmates decades ago.

Oldest Inmate: One of J Ward’s most famous residents, Bill Wallace, lived here for over 60 years and died at the ripe old age of 107!

Famous Footsteps: Infamous figures like Mark “Chopper” Read were once housed within these very walls.
